Decrease of Rs 14 crore recorded in amount defrauded by cyber criminals this year : Shatrujeet Kapur

Taking action against cyber criminals, Haryana Police arrested 4 times more criminals in January 2025 compared to last year

The effective strategy devised by the Haryana Police to protect people from cyber criminals has started yielding remarkable results. In January 2025, a decrease of Rs 14 crore was recorded in the amount defrauded by cyber criminals compared to January 2024. Not only this, the Haryana Police has succeeded in sending 433 more cyber criminals behind bars in January 2025 as compared to the previous year.

Giving information about this, Director General of Police Shatrujeet Kapur said due to the awareness campaign being run by the Haryana Police, the defrauded amount has decreased to Rs 72.84 crore this year as compared to Rs 86.18 crore in January 2024. As a result of the prompt action of the Haryana Police, a significant increase has also been recorded in the amount saved from cyber criminals in January 2025 compared to January 2024. 

Taking strict action against cyber criminals, the Haryana Police has arrested 4 times more criminals in January 2025. While 138 cyber accused were arrested by the Haryana Police in January 2024, 571 accused have been arrested in January 2025, out of which 130 accused are from Haryana and 441 accused are from other states.

It is noteworthy that the Haryana Police has saved an amount of approximately Rs 268.40 crore from the clutches of cyber criminals in the year 2024, while this amount was only Rs 76.85 crore in the year 2023. In this way, three times more amount has been saved from cyber criminals in the year 2024 as compared to the year 2023 and five times more amount has been saved as compared to the year 2022. 

Similarly, where 2165 cases were registered against cyber criminals in the year 2022, 2747 cases were registered in the year 2023 and 5511 cases have been registered in the year 2024. Similarly, 1078 cyber criminals were arrested by the Haryana Police in the year 2022, 1909 in the year 2023 and 5156 in the year 2024. 

Out of the criminals arrested in the year 2024, 70 percent (3555 criminals) are residents of other states. In the year 2024, an average of 14 cyber criminals have been arrested daily by the Haryana Police. The Haryana Police, which was at the 23rd position in the country in September 2023 in terms of the rate of blocked amount of cyber fraud, has now reached the first position. 

For this achievement and efficient implementation of cyber helpline 1930, the Haryana Police was also honoured by the Union Home Minister Sh. Amit Shah on September 10, 2024. As a result of these actions taken by the Haryana Police to control Cyber Crime, the rate of blocked amount in cyber fraud and the recovery being done by the cyber police stations, which was 7 percent in September 2023, has increased to 36 percent in December 2024, which is the highest in the country. 

Not only this, if a complainant files a complaint within 6 hours of cyber fraud, up to 70 percent of the defrauded amount is being blocked, which is the highest in the entire country.  While appealing to the general public, Sh. Kapur said in this era of technology, most people are active on online platforms. If any person calls and introduces himself as an officer of CBI, ED or police and talks about digital arrest, then be immediately alert because no agency does digital arrest. 

Along with this, people should not fall into the trap of fake share trading being broadcast on social media platforms. Before investing, be sure to officially confirm the company and website. Along with this, people should not pick up WhatsApp video and audio calls coming from abroad, especially from Cambodia, Pakistan, Sri Lanka etc. 

The Haryana Police is continuously running awareness campaigns on print and social media to make the people of the state aware about the methods adopted by cyber criminals. The only way to avoid cyber crime is caution and vigilance, so people should be vigilant and contact helpline number-1930 immediately if there is any apprehension of cyber crime.
